What does a Typical Day Look Like?

Working with NDIS clients offers a unique chance to cultivate lasting relationships with those you're assisting. This role is well-suited for individuals who will be providing personalized assistance to participants with challenging behaviours, enhancing the Participant's capabilities, assisting with daily tasks, implementing strategies as part of their BSP, maintaining documentation and tracking methodology while working in a 24/7 dedicated Care Team.    

About The Role

We are looking for Disability Support Workers who can make a positive impact on the lives of individuals with complex behaviours and mental health. Assist Participants to achieve their goals, enhance their community participation and promote inclusivity. 

Responsibilities:

  • Empower Participants to exercise personal choice, initiative, independence and self-expression

  • Ability to report and manage potential risks, Restrictive Practices and incidents 

  • Implement Behaviour Support Plan strategies and document relevant information requested by the PBS Practitioner 

  • Utilize your training in mental health to support participants to remain in recovery and engaged with supports  

  • Provide enjoyable and safe environments for participants

  • Support individual interests, hobbies, and relationships

  • Engage actively with participants, fostering personal growth

  • Ensure privacy, dignity, and confidentiality

  • Assist with personal care, meal preparation, medication administration & transportation

  • Provide accurate and detailed incident reports, progress notes and shift handovers

  • Handle administrative tasks with discretion and sensitivity
